About the Role BlueAlly is hiring a Senior Consultant to design, implement, and migrate Microsoft cloud infrastructure for clients across state and local government, education, healthcare, utilities and cooperatives, nonprofits, and midmarket enterprise. This role spans Microsoft Entra ID, Microsoft 365, Microsoft Intune, Microsoft Purview, Microsoft Defender, and Azure infrastructure. You will deliver across concurrent client engagements, contribute technical input to solution scoping and estimation, and act as a trusted technical point of contact for client stakeholders from IT administrators through executive sponsors. We are looking for someone who can operate with incomplete information, make defensible assumptions, document them, and keep an engagement moving. Responsibilities Solution Design and Delivery Assess client environments and requirements, and design solutions that meet stated business and technical objectives. Lead or participate in Microsoft tenant migrations: tenant-to-tenant, on-premises to cloud, hybrid coexistence, and third-party platform sources. Configure and remediate Microsoft Entra ID, including Conditional Access, MFA, Privileged Identity Management, self-service password reset with password writeback, B2B and B2C, cross-tenant synchronization, hybrid identity, and ADFS-to-SAML modernization. Deploy passwordless authentication, including Windows Hello for Business using cloud Kerberos trust and FIDO2 security keys. Deploy and modernize endpoint management: Microsoft Intune, Windows Autopilot, Configuration Manager coexistence and transition, compliance policies, configuration profiles, update rings, application packaging, and OneDrive Known Folder Move. Implement Microsoft Purview data protection: sensitivity labels, data loss prevention, retention and records management, and eDiscovery. Deploy Microsoft Defender for Endpoint, Defender for Cloud, and Defender for Identity, including migration from third-party EDR platforms. Manage and troubleshoot escalated issues across identity, data protection, and device management. Azure Infrastructure Perform Azure Migrate assessments and execute server and workload migrations, including wave planning, cutover scheduling, and application-owner validation. Design and implement Azure networking, including VPN Gateway, Application Gateway and WAF, Bastion, and Front Door. Implement Azure Backup and Azure Site Recovery to meet client recovery objectives. Size and deploy Azure compute and storage, including Azure Files and storage account configuration. Deliver Azure Virtual Desktop and Windows 365 proofs of value and production deployments. Required Qualifications Five or more years delivering Microsoft cloud infrastructure in a consulting, managed services provider, or enterprise engineering capacity. Demonstrated ownership of at least three end-to-end Microsoft 365 or Azure migration projects, including planning, execution, and cutover. Deep hands-on experience with Microsoft Entra ID and Microsoft 365 workloads, including Exchange Online, SharePoint Online, OneDrive for Business, and Microsoft Teams. Deep hands-on experience with Microsoft Intune and Windows endpoint management. Working knowledge of Azure IaaS: virtual machine sizing, storage, core networking, and backup. Practical experience with Microsoft Purview data protection and the Microsoft Defender suite. PowerShell and Microsoft Graph proficiency for automation, reporting, and bulk operations. Ability to manage multiple concurrent client engagements and shifting priorities. Excellent written and verbal communication; able to lead a client-facing technical discussion independently. Preferred Qualifications Azure Virtual Desktop or Windows 365 deployment experience. Hypervisor migration experience, such as VMware to Hyper-V or VMware to Azure. Third-party migration tooling: AvePoint Fly, Quest, BitTitan, or ShareGate. macOS, iOS, and Android management. Delivery experience in regulated or public-sector environments: HIPAA, CJIS, FERPA, SOC 2, or NERC CIP. Microsoft Sentinel exposure.
